Understanding Hair Loss and PRP Treatment

Causes of Hair Loss

Hair loss can be attributed to various factors, including genetics, hormonal changes, and medical conditions. Genetic predisposition plays a significant role in determining the pattern and extent of hair loss experienced by individuals. Hormonal changes, particularly those related to ageing, pregnancy, and menopause, can also contribute to hair thinning and loss. Additionally, certain medical conditions such as alopecia areata and thyroid disorders can lead to significant hair shedding. Understanding these underlying causes is crucial in determining the most suitable treatment approach for addressing hair loss concerns.

Benefits of PRP Treatment

PRP treatment offers a range of benefits for individuals experiencing hair loss. By harnessing the body's natural healing mechanisms, PRP stimulates natural hair growth and enhances overall hair thickness. The procedure involves extracting a sample of the patient's blood, processing it to isolate the platelet-rich plasma, and then injecting it into the scalp. This concentrated growth factor promotes cell regeneration and tissue repair in the targeted areas, leading to improved hair density and coverage. As a non-invasive and natural solution, PRP treatment has gained recognition for its effectiveness in addressing hair loss concerns.

Comparing PRP with Other Treatments

Comparison with Hair Transplants

When comparing PRP treatment with hair transplants, one notable distinction is the invasiveness of the procedures. While hair transplants involve surgical intervention to relocate hair follicles from one part of the scalp to another, PRP treatment is non-invasive. This means that PRP treatment does not require any surgical incisions or stitches, leading to a quicker recovery time and fewer associated risks. Additionally, the natural approach of PRP treatment appeals to individuals looking for a minimally invasive solution to their hair loss concerns.

Comparison with Medications

In contrast to medications commonly used for addressing hair loss, PRP treatment offers a distinct advantage in avoiding potential side effects. Many medications prescribed for hair loss may have adverse effects such as sexual dysfunction, dizziness, and allergic reactions. On the other hand, PRP treatment utilises the body's own platelet-rich plasma to stimulate natural hair growth, eliminating the need for synthetic drugs and their associated risks.

The Cost and Recovery of PRP Treatment

Cost of PRP Treatment

The cost of PRP treatment for hair loss can vary depending on several factors, including the specific clinic or medical facility where the procedure is performed and the geographical location. Generally, the cost may range from a few hundred to a few thousand pounds. It's essential for individuals considering PRP treatment to consult with their healthcare provider or a specialist to obtain an accurate cost estimate based on their unique requirements and the extent of the treatment needed. Factors such as the number of sessions required and any additional services offered as part of the treatment package can also influence the overall cost.
